Field Service Technician - Job Description Tecogen Field Service Technicians work on our energy-efficient line of stationary engines and assist with territory operations.
This position provides the opportunity to work for one of the largest cogeneration companies in the area, providing combined heat and power as well as cooling to our customers. The successful applicant will report to the Field Service Supervisor.

Field Service Technician Responsibilities:
Assist in scheduled maintenance tasks for assigned territory clients
Develop the appropriate procedures for logging work in compliance with established guidelines
Takes ownership of company assigned tools
Works directly with an assigned and experienced service technician for mandatory training including but not limited to, o Client specifications o Different types of generators in place on client site(s) o Intermediate knowledge of refrigeration cycle o Intermediate knowledge of electronic circuits o Intermediate knowledge of engine diagnostics o Intermediate knowledge of engine repair o Perform on-site and shop maintenance and cleaning of systems (HX flush, punch tubes, etc.
) o Perform minor electrical and sensor repairs to field equipment o Begin to work on minor Schedule A and B maintenance on equipment (oil changes, leaks, hoses, etc.) o Assist other Technicians on major engine work to aid in training o Takes full ownership of assigned company provided tools o Assists coworkers with necessary on-site housekeeping and/or organization of warehouse area o Responsible for cleanliness and maintenance of company issued vehicle, either solely or in partnership with other assigned high level technician o Responsible for safety protocols to assigned jobs o All other duties as assigned
Field Service Technician Qualifications:
Previous experience as Apprentice Field Service Technician preferred
Clean and valid driver's license (operates company supplied vehicle)
Ability to read and follow manuals, electrical, and mechanical diagrams
Trade school certificaiton in Mechanics preferred
Motivation to become self-sufficient and educated on Tecogen products and troubleshooting techniques
Ability to be flexible with changing daily priorities in a fast-paced environment
Physical Requirements:
Driving company vehicle
Constant sitting, standing, squatting, kneeling, and lifting up to 50 pounds
Client sites may vary
Frequent exposure to varying weather conditions
